In this paper, the authors propose a pointer forwarding scheme with mobility-aware binding update in Hierarchical Mobile IPv6 networks. In the proposed scheme, a pointer chain between Access Routers (ARs) is established to reduce the Binding Update (BU) traffic to the Mobility Anchor Point (MAP). In addition, the MN performs a binding update to the Correspondent Node (CN) depending on its mobility. Specifically, an on-Link Care-of Address (LCoA) is chosen for the MN with low mobility whereas a Regional Care-of-Address (RCoA) is selected for the MN with high mobility. This mobility-aware binding update can reduce the packet delivery overhead in an adaptive manner.
